Date: Mon, 17 Jul 2000 08:42:54 -0500 MIME-Version: 1.0 X-Mailer: Internet Mail Service (5.5.2650.21) Content-Type: text/plain Using the new setup on my Win95 "system", I received a pop-up advising: warning: deleting "c:/cygwin/tmp" so I can make a directory there with an OK button on it. Before clicking the button, I checked and the "c:/cygwin/tmp" was already gone. My original "c:/cygwin/tmp" was a symlink to a real "c:/tmp" directory, so nothing was lost but I would have hoped the warning message would appear before the action had been taken. -- Want to unsubscribe from this list?
